超长距离水平MJS地基加固施工实例分析  被引量:4

摘  要:日本国土面积小、城市建筑密集,为适应城市建设发展需要,早在1982年业已研究出较为成熟的管幕暗挖工法。我国在上海轨道交通14号线桂桥路站首次应用管幕暗挖工法进行车站主体结构施工。主要介绍管幕暗挖工法之超长距离水平MJS工法桩地基加固施工质量控制,施工时的水平度、水灰比、地内压力是水平MJS工法施工成败的关键,由于MJS工法具有孔内强制排浆功能,为合理控制排浆量,保证地内压力处于平衡状态,因而设定的地内压力控制值与施工深度的比值,从而有效控制地基加固质量,保证周边环境安全。Japan has a small land area and dense urban buildings.In order to adapt the needs of urban construction and development,early in 1980,a more nature method of underground excavation for pipe curtain has been studied.The method of underground excavation for pipe curtain is firstly used in Guiqiao Road Station of Shanghai Metro Line 14 to construct the main structure of the station.The quality control of reinforcement construction of extra-long distance horizontal MJS pile subgrade by the method of underground excavation for pipe curtain is mainly introduced.The level degree,water cement ratio and pressure in ground during the construction are the key to the success or failure of horizontal MJS construction.Because MJS method has the function of forced grouting in the hole,in order to reasonably control the discharge amount and to keep the pressure in the ground in balance,therefore,the ratio of the pressure control value in the ground to the construction depth is set so as to efficiently control the reinforcement quality of subgrade and to ensure the safety of the surrounding environment.

关 键 词:超长距离 水平MJS工法桩 地基加固 水灰比 地内压力
